Transaction 743b34d902a909a665045d11b1212316942c32ec793f27853099a9321851aa1d
1 Input
2 Outputs
- 743b34d902a909a665045d11b1212316942c32ec793f27853099a9321851aa1d:0
- 743b34d902a909a665045d11b1212316942c32ec793f27853099a9321851aa1d:1
value 69348
address 1FtMuF4VSpBjMDBrRT7NjaFPJUY5CSrKT8
value 6934835
address 358hFG4CRbEK2YbtY3kF9Wy1Y6aHaMK9ty